What are Conex Containers?
Conex containers are standardized metal containers used for transferring products. Originally designed for Shipping Container Rental by sea, these containers are now extensively used for storage, temporary housing, and even innovative architectural jobs. The term "Conex" stemmed from the term "container express," which encapsulated the essence of expedited shipping.

The history of Conex containers go back to the early 1950s. The intro of the ISO standardization enabled intermodal transport, assisting in smooth cargo motion by rail, road, and sea. The standardization likewise made sure toughness and security, making them ideal for long-distance journeys. Over the years, the design and structure have actually progressed to include contemporary features, consisting of insulation for temperature-sensitive goods and integrated RFID technology for tracking deliveries.

Conex containers present various benefits across numerous applications:
Durability and Strength
Constructed from high-quality steel, these containers are designed to stand up to extreme weather and are resistant to corrosion.
Cost-Effectiveness
Compared to standard construction approaches or storage centers, Conex containers are a budget-friendly alternative. Their availability in the used market can significantly reduce costs.
Customizability
Containers can be modified to suit particular needs, including the addition of windows, doors, electrical systems, and HVAC systems.
Movement
Easily easily transportable, they can be moved utilizing trucks or cranes, making them an ideal option for moving workplaces or short-term setups.
Security
Lockable and strong in nature, Conex containers provide an added layer of security for important items.
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)1. How much do Conex containers cost?
The rate of a Conex container varies widely based on size, condition (new vs. Used Shipping Containers), and modifications. Usually, used containers can vary from ₤ 1,500 to ₤ 3,500, while new containers may cost between ₤ 3,000 and ₤ 5,000.
2. Do Conex containers require licenses for installation?
It depends upon regional policies. Numerous towns need authorizations for container usage, especially if they are modified or used for domestic purposes. Constantly examine regional zoning laws.
3. What is the lifespan of a Conex container?
A properly maintained Conex container can last in between 10 to 25 years, depending upon environmental conditions and usage.
4. Can Conex containers be insulated?
Yes, containers can be insulated to make sure heat in colder climates or to control temperature-sensitive merchandise. Professional insulation techniques exist to maintain structural integrity.
5. Are Conex containers ecologically friendly?
Yes, repurposing Conex containers for different uses can decrease waste and lower the carbon footprint connected with conventional construction methods.
6. How do I pick the best size Conex container?
Think about the intended use, storage requirements, and offered area. Standard sizes include 20-foot and 40-foot containers, but there are multiple sizes offered to meet various needs.
